Nepal records 181 new COVID-19 cases, one death in last 24 hours

Kathmandu valley witnesses 83 fresh coronavirus cases



KATHMANDU: Nepal recorded a total of 181 new cases of coronavirus infection in the past 24 hours.

According to the Ministry of Health and Population, 133 persons tested positive for COVID-19 through the RT-PCR method while 48 tested positive through the Antigen method.

According to the Ministry, 64 persons in Kathmandu, 13 in Lalitpur, and 6 in Bhaktapur have been tested positive for COVID-19, making the Kathmandu valley’s fresh coronavirus cases 83 in the past 24 hours.

According to the Ministry, one person has succumbed to COVID-19 in the past 24 hours taking the coronavirus death toll in the country 11,573 till date.

Meanwhile, 289 persons have returned home after a complete health recovery from COVID-19.
